Heart Aerospace is seeking a Propulsion Test Engineer to lead the testing and validation of their hybrid-electric powertrain system for the ES-30 aircraft. The role involves collaboration with various engineering teams and requires a strong background in propulsion and test engineering, particularly with electric systems
Job Summary
Lead the testing, validation and certification of the aircraft’s hybrid-electric powertrain system.
Design and commission hybrid-electric propulsion test stands, HIL, and Digital Twin, including instrumentation, safety systems, control systems, and data acquisition.
Analyze test data, prepare reports, and provide feedback to design teams for iterative development.
